City of Fredericksburg: frequently asked questions
Is City of Fredericksburg's water safe to drink?
City of Fredericksburg is an active community water system regulated under the Safe Drinking Water Act, overseen by the TX state drinking water program. EPA SDWA violation and enforcement records for this system are being added to AquaCensus from EPA ECHO; consult EPA ECHO or your annual Consumer Confidence Report for its current compliance status.
Who runs City of Fredericksburg?
City of Fredericksburg (PWSID TX0860001) is a local government-owned community water system, regulated by the TX state drinking water program.
How many people does City of Fredericksburg serve?
City of Fredericksburg reports serving 11,257 people through 7,631 service connections in Gillespie County, Texas.
Where does City of Fredericksburg get its water?
EPA SDWIS lists this system's primary water source as groundwater.
